    @neilme I wasn’t referring to customizing the default structured workout screen, that’s not possible in any Suunto as you said, but I was saying that only on Suunto Run you cannot add your own screens to the structured workout. On all other Suunto watches, while you cannot customize the Suunto Guide screen, you can add your own screens along side, this isn’t the case for Suunto Run. Interval pace, interval distance on Suunto Run are useless right now, you won’t see them during a structured workout because on Suunto Run as I said before, you cannot add your own screens, so you’re left with a few screens Suunto makes available during structure workouts and that’s it.

    @Gilles-Maiol-Vendranas-Rullier I was in the same loop just last week with my 9 Peak Pro. Really frustrating! What helped in my case is that I removed all paired BT devices/sensors from the watch and restarted and repaired the watch with the phone. Coincidentally or not, it started happening right after I enabled dual-BLE on my HR strap. After the actions taken above it works again, sort of. The weather doesn’t get updated automatically like it used to and “find my phone” function fell off too. No idea why Suunto is doing this to us. Time to figure it out.
